Just a quick note on our test system specs before we dig into benchmark specifics:  In all our test setups, we used an NVIDIA GeForce 6800 GT graphics card.  In the case of the PCI Express-capable Intel systems, we used the NV45 version of the GF 6800 GT, and for the AGP graphics-based systems, we used standard GeForce 6800 GT AGP cards.  In both cases, GPU core and memory clock speeds were identical.  For the Intel-based systems, we used the latest chipset drivers provided with the i925XE launch kit.  In all cases, we were making an effort to utilize identical components across the various Intel and AMD platforms wherever possible.

Preliminary Benchmarks With SiSoft SANDRA 2004
Synthetic Testing

We began our testing with SiSoftware's SANDRA, the System ANalyzer, Diagnostic, and Reporting Assistant. SANDRA consists of a set of information and diagnostic utilities that test some basic metrics on major subsystem performance levels in a number of areas. We ran three of the built-in subsystem tests that comprise the SANDRA 2004 suite: CPU, Multimedia, and the Memory test, which is based on the "Stream" memory benchmark algorithm.


    
P4 EE 3.46GHz 1066MHz FSB - Intel i925XE Chipset

 

      
P4 EE 3.4GHz 800MHz FSB - Intel i925X Chipset

We've taken scores from an 800MHz FSB P4 EE at 3.4GHz and compared them for you here versus the new 3.46GHz P4 EE with 1066MHz FSB. We should also point out again that both test systems are running system memory at CAS 3, 3, 3, 8 timings. The scores at this setting are actually slightly better than stardard DDR400 RAM at CAS2. As you'll note, the only major difference that is reported in these Sandra test modules are the memory bandwidth scores.  There's about a 14% advantage in overall memory bandwidth for the i925XE system.  Beyond that, the P4 EE 3.46GHz chip scores only marginally better than a standard P4 EE 3.4GHz 800MHz FSB chip, in floating point and integer performance.
